Abstract
The multiplexing efficiency of high order MIMO in mobile terminal at 15GHz for 5G communication is studied in this paper. The multiplexing efficiency of two MIMO topologies are compared is calculated with a narrow angular spread Gaussian distributed incoming wave model in order to illustrate the mm wave channel characterize.
